English Abstract:This study empirically estimates how much FTAs affect domestic inflation rates. Most previous studies … is an econometric estimation of the price stabilization due to FTAs and an analysis of how FTAs affect inflation rates … the weighted price index, we find that FTAs reduce the CPI inflation rate by 0.76%p at an annual basis from the second …

English Abstract: This paper analyzes the impact of foreign capital inflow on inflation, centering on the exchange rate … prices due to the won's appreciation, consequently causing the downward pressure on inflation. Meanwhile, the effect of total … demand leads to the upward pressure on inflation since foreign capital inflow encourages private consumption and investment …

English Abstract: This study examines the influence of global and country factors on inflation movements in Korea using … a multilevel factor model. Our results indicate that global factors were significant drivers of inflation in Korea … during the high inflation era of the 1970s, as well as in recent periods following the COVID-19 pandemic.
